Vapor barrier installation services involve the placement of specialized membranes or sheets designed to prevent moisture from penetrating building structures. These barriers are typically installed in areas prone to dampness, such as basements, crawl spaces, and underneath concrete slabs. The process often includes preparing the surface, laying out the vapor barrier material, and sealing the edges to ensure an effective moisture barrier. Proper installation helps maintain a dry environment within the property, reducing the risk of water-related issues over time.
One of the primary problems vapor barrier installation addresses is excess moisture infiltration, which can lead to a variety of property issues. Persistent dampness can cause mold growth, wood rot, and deterioration of building materials, compromising structural integrity and indoor air quality. Installing a vapor barrier helps mitigate these problems by creating a protective layer that blocks moisture from seeping into interior spaces. This service can be especially beneficial in areas with high humidity or poor drainage, where moisture control is essential for maintaining a healthy and durable property.

Professionals providing vapor barrier installation typically work with a variety of materials, including polyethylene sheets, foil-backed membranes, and other moisture-resistant products. The selection of material depends on the specific needs of the property and the location of installation. Material Costs - The cost of vapor barrier materials typically ranges from $0.25 to $0.75 per square foot, depending on the type and quality selected. For a standard basement, material expenses can vary widely based on size and specifications.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or costs generally fall between $1.00 and $2.50 per square foot. Larger or more complex projects may incur higher labor charges from local service providers.
Total Project Cost - Overall costs for vapor barrier installation usually range from $500 to $2,500, influenced by the project's size and specific requirements. These estimates can vary significantly across different locations and providers.
Additional Factors - Costs may increase if surface preparation, additional insulation, or moisture testing are needed. It is recommended to contact local contractors for precise quotes tailored to individual project need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a vapor barrier? A vapor barrier is a material installed to prevent moisture from passing through walls, floors, or ceilings, helping to control humidity levels indoors.
Where is a vapor barrier typically installed? Vapor barriers are commonly placed in crawl spaces, basements, or beneath concrete slabs to reduce moisture infiltration.
What materials are used for vapor barriers? Common vapor barrier materials include polyethylene plastic sheets, foil-faced membranes, and other moisture-resistant sheets designed for building applications.
How long does vapor barrier installation usually take? The duration of installation varies depending on the area size and complexity but is generally completed within a day or two by local service providers.
